The Leutkirch wastewater treatment plant operates a municipal wastewater treatment plant designed for 100,000 PE with upstream denitrification and chemical phosphate precipitation.
Precipitant products with 2-valent (FeCl2) or 3-valent iron (FeCl3 / FeClSO4 / Fe2(SO4)3) can be used for phosphate precipitation.
Two storage tanks made of PE-HD, each with a volume of 30 m³, are available for precipitant storage (total volume 60 m³).
In relation to the active ingredient, the annual precipitant consumption is approx. 2,300 kmol.
The precipitant must have an active substance content of at least 2 moles per litre. The product offered must also be frost-resistant up to a maximum of -15° C (incipient crystallization).
Approved precipitants as a liquid solution are:
Iron(II) chloride (FeCl2)
Iron(III) chloride (FeCl3)
Eisen(III)-chloridsulfat (FeClSO4)
Ferrous sulphate (Fe2(SO4)3)

The precipitant must be delivered in a tanker (approx. 22 to 26 tonnes) – after retrieval within 5 working days. The quantities delivered must be documented with official weighing slips showing the weights gross, tare, net and the registration plates of the vehicles.
Orders of the iron-based precipitant are made about 1 to 2 times a week.
